martinsecrest Posted January 12, 2010 Share Posted January 12, 2010 I appreciate any help in determining the date of my guitar. Serial number is 72189039. I believe it was made in the late 70's or early 80's, but I really don't know.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
martinsecrest Posted January 12, 2010 Author Share Posted January 12, 2010 OK, a little research done now -- it looks as though perhaps this guitar was made Feb. 18, 1979 in Kalamazoo? It does have a barely-hanging-on sticker inside that indicates Kalamazoo. This date would square up with roughly the correct time frame that was indicated when I bought it about 1985. ksdaddy Posted January 12, 2010 Share Posted January 12, 2010 You're close. It's a '79 made in Kalamazoo, the 39th one stamped that day. However it was stamped on the 218th day (August 6th).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

martinsecrest Posted January 13, 2010 Author Share Posted January 13, 2010 A vintage site has posted a price guide for the 175D as below. Are they dreaming? Vintage Price Value For 2008 : 1952 - 1956 > $5500 to $7000 ( p-90 ) 1957 - 1959 > $11000 to $13000 ( Humbuckers ) 1960 - 1963 > $5000 to $7500 1964 - 1966 > $3900 to $5700 1967 - 1969 > $3300 to $4000 ( various colors ) 1970 - 1979 > $3000 to $3500 1980 - 1999 > $2000 to $2500 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
